More about the book

Delving into the life of William Sharp, this book uncovers his secret identity as Fiona Macleod, a pivotal figure in the occult circles of the late Victorian era. It explores his connections with notable contemporaries like W.B. Yeats and his involvement in mystical societies. The work reveals previously hidden aspects of Sharp's life and highlights the rich Faery magical lore embedded in Macleod's writings, presenting authentic accounts of Faery gods, beliefs, and magic. This exploration significantly enhances the understanding of this often-misunderstood subject.
